Junichiro Tokuoka was the Director of the Japanese language version of The World.




Localizing The World

Tokuoka is renowned as an eccentric lead programmer. His team's work schedule revolved around his bizarre sleeping habits, termed "Tokuoka Time." When he woke up was "morning;" when he had his first meal was "noon;" when he went out to drink was "evening." The team worked according to Tokuoka Time regardless of what the actual time was. Although his work would lead to success, he was soon discarded after The World's completion.

Quest for Truth

Tokuoka blamed himself and CCCorp for not realizing the flaw within The World sooner and began investigating the cause behind the comatose victims. Although CCCorp threatened him not to pursue the subject, he did so. Tokuoka knows that CCCorp is as aware of the flaw as he is, but without proof, he has no case.

Tokuoka's investigation led him to Mai Minase, a girl who fell into a coma due to the game yet awoke shortly after. Her help allowed him to experience firsthand the power within the game. During his time with Mai he had the chance to search Tomonari Kasumi's account data and stumbled across the users Yukichin (Yuki Aihara) and Kyo (Kyoko Tohno) and decided to contact and inform them of the situation.

When Tokuoka met with Kyoko to discuss the The Epitaph of Twilight, he was approached by Helba's subordinate, Bith the Black. Bith revealed his knowledge of the inner workings of The World and what Harald hid within it. He then asked for Tokuoka's assistance in freeing the Ultimate AI from the grasp of the wayward Morganna. Tokuoka agreed to this.

It was due to the combined efforts of Tokuoka and Mai that the server in which Kite's party battled Morganna was successfully replaced, allowing them to continue the battle and eventually win. Although Tokuoka would be captured during his escape, he would walk away the victor; Tokuoka had in his position the data the linked The World to the coma incidents, and he now had a chance against CCCorp.
